Lake St. Bernard, or Lago São Bernardo, is a picturesque lake located in the charming town of São Francisco de Paula, Brazil. Surrounded by lush forests and rolling hills, it's a serene destination perfect for nature lovers seeking relaxation and outdoor activities.

Getting There
-
Public Transport
From Gramado, take a bus to São Francisco de Paula. Buses run regularly from the Gramado bus station, and the journey takes about 1 hour. Upon arriving in São Francisco de Paula, you can walk to the lake, approximately 8 km from the bus station, or take a local taxi or rideshare service. A bus ticket from São Francisco de Paula to Canela costs around R$17.20. Be sure to check the bus schedule for the return trip to Gramado, as services may be limited in the evening.
-
Taxi/Rideshare
If you prefer a more direct route, you can book a taxi or use a rideshare app from anywhere in Serra Gaúcha to Lake St. Bernard. This option is convenient if you're traveling in a group. Expect to pay around R$50 to R$100 for a ride from Gramado or Canela to the lake. Confirm the fare with the driver before starting your journey. Uber is available in São Francisco de Paula.
-
Driving
If driving from Gramado, take the RS-115 highway towards São Francisco de Paula. After approximately 30 km, take the exit towards RS-020. Follow this road for about 15 km until you reach the town of São Francisco de Paula. Once in town, follow the signs to Lake St. Bernard (Lago São Bernardo). The lake is located approximately 8 km from the town center. Parking may be available near the lake for a fee.
